Abstract
The agricultural field requires hard work and enough human resources to complete any agriculture tasks. Apart from these requirements, maintenance costs and services of the agricultural equipment have also to be considered. Therefore, according to the agricultural work essentials, the workforce has to be increased, and productivity can also be improved. However, it is not easy to find a human resource under certain rash circumstances. By then, the productivity of agriculture may get affected; to overcome this issue, specific intelligent systems can be introduced to manage the productivity of the provincial states of the country. According to the requirement of agricultural productivity, intelligent sensors can be fixed in the agricultural land to monitor the status of the land and crops to take precautionary actions. To implement this intelligent technology in this research, wireless sensors are fixed to collect data and perform analysis with the aid of intelligent decision support systems. The study results proved that the provincial countries have obtained increased agricultural production from 2014 to 2020.
